b q/< button Viewing pictures/Printing pictures q Viewing pictures immediately Press q in shooting mode to switch to playback mode and display the last picture taken. Press q again or press the shutter button halfway to return to shooting mode. g "q Viewing still pictures/Selecting playback mode" (P. 13) < Printing pictures When a printer is connected to the camera, display the picture you want to print in playback mode and press

Press
f
in shooting mode to turn on or off Shadow Adjustment Technology. Press
e
to
set. A rectangular frame appears on the detected shadowy area. This function makes the
subject’s face appear brighter even against backlight and enhances the background in the
picture.
•
There may be cases in which the camera cannot detect a face.
•
When [SHADOW ADJ. ON] is selected, the following setting restrictions apply.
• [ESP/
n
] is fixed at [ESP].
•
[AF MODE] is fixed at [FACE DETECT].
•
[PANORAMA] is not available.
•
When [DRIVE] is set to [
W
], this function activates only for the first shot.
•
In some cases, it takes some time to display a detection frame.
In playback mode, select the picture you want to erase, and press
S
.
•
Once erased, pictures cannot be restored. Check each picture before erasing to avoid
accidentally erasing pictures you want to keep.
